Calibration Best Practices

Proper calibration ensures your projector displays the best possible image. Follow these steps regularly:

Initial Setup

Place the projector on a stable surface at the recommended distance from the screen. Use the built-in lens shift and zoom features to align the image properly. Ensure the room lighting is controlled during calibration.

Color and Brightness Calibration

Use a calibration disc or professional calibration tools to adjust the color temperature, contrast, and brightness. Sony’s calibration presets can serve as a starting point, but fine-tuning yields optimal results.

Utilizing Calibration Software

Leverage software compatible with your projector for precise adjustments. Regular calibration, ideally every 6 to 12 months, maintains image fidelity.

Maintenance Tips

Consistent maintenance extends the lifespan of your VPL-XW5000ES and ensures peak performance. Follow these guidelines:

Cleaning the Lens

Use a soft, lint-free cloth and lens cleaning solution to gently remove dust and smudges. Avoid abrasive materials that could scratch the lens surface.

Replacing the Laser Module

The laser light source has a lifespan of approximately 20,000 hours. Monitor usage and replace the laser module as recommended by Sony to maintain brightness and color accuracy.

Ventilation and Environment

Ensure the projector is placed in a well-ventilated area. Keep dust and debris away from vents. Regularly check and clean air filters to prevent overheating.
